| dc.description | This study explores the strategic management of higher education in response to technological advancements and global shifts. Using a mixed-methods approach that combines quantitative surveys and qualitative interviews, it gathers insights from administrators and students across various institutions. The findings indicate a significant transition toward technology-enhanced learning environments, underscoring the need for adaptive management strategies aligned with the digital age and global competition. The research highlights the crucial role of innovative leadership in leveraging online educational platforms and digital tools to navigate emerging challenges and opportunities. Ultimately, it advocates for higher education institutions to adopt flexible and dynamic management approaches to succeed in an evolving global educational landscape. | en-US |
